53 Fielding Regulations These must be adhered to, and enforced by the umpires and captains • No young player in the Under 15 age group or younger shall be allowed to field closer than 8 yards (7.3 metres) from the middle stump, except behind the wicket on the off side, until the batsman has played at the ball. • For players in the Under 13 age group the distance is 11 yards • (10 metres). • These minimum distances apply even if the player is wearing a helmet. • Should a young player in these age groups come within the restricted distance the umpire must stop the game immediately and instruct the fielder to move -back. • In addition any young player in the Under 16 to Under 18 age groups, who have not reached the age of 18, must wear a helmet and, for boys, an abdominal protector (box) when fielding within 6 yards (5.5 metres) of the bat, except behind the wicket on the off side. Players should wear appropriate protective -equipment whenever they are fielding in a position where they feel at risk. Child Protection All clubs must recognise that they have a duty of care towards all young players who are representing the club. This duty of care also extends to Leagues that allow the participation of young players in adult teams and this League has adopted the ECB Safe hands Policy. The duty of care should be interpreted in two ways: • not to place a young player in a position that involves an unreasonable risk to that young player, taking account of the circumstances of the match and the relative skills of the player. • not to create a situation that places members of the opposing side in a position whereby they cannot play cricket as they would normally do against adult players.
